module Dev: sig .. end
type t = {
   | 
iface : string; | 
   | 
rx_bytes : int; | 
   | 
rx_packets : int; | 
   | 
rx_errs : int; | 
   | 
rx_drop : int; | 
   | 
rx_fifo : int; | 
   | 
rx_frame : int; | 
   | 
rx_compressed : bool; | 
   | 
rx_multicast : bool; | 
   | 
tx_bytes : int; | 
   | 
tx_packets : int; | 
   | 
tx_errs : int; | 
   | 
tx_drop : int; | 
   | 
tx_fifo : int; | 
   | 
tx_colls : int; | 
   | 
tx_carrier : int; | 
   | 
tx_compressed : bool; | 
}
val tx_compressed : t -> bool
val tx_carrier : t -> int
val tx_colls : t -> int
val tx_fifo : t -> int
val tx_drop : t -> int
val tx_errs : t -> int
val tx_packets : t -> int
val tx_bytes : t -> int
val rx_multicast : t -> bool
val rx_compressed : t -> bool
val rx_frame : t -> int
val rx_fifo : t -> int
val rx_drop : t -> int
val rx_errs : t -> int
val rx_packets : t -> int
val rx_bytes : t -> int
val iface : t -> string
module Fields: sig .. end
val interfaces : unit -> string list
val of_string : string -> t option